FBI Conference Call Hacked and Recorded by Anonymous Hackers [Audio Available]

Yesterday it was revealed by Anonymous that they have hacked confidential call between FBI and British intelligence agency. The call is a 16-minute long discussion between both agencies about ongoing investigations related to Anonymous LulzSec and AntiSec.

According to Anonymous Hackers on twitter ” “The FBI might be curious how we’re able to continuously read their internal comms for some time now, we broke into the e-mail accounts of investigators to gain the call-in details.

According to TheHackerNews”The email with details for accessing the call was sent to law enforcement officials in Britain, France, the Netherlands and others but the only people who identify themselves on the call are from the FBI and Scotland Yard.In a message on Twitter, Anonymous posted links to the audio recording and said the FBI “might be curious how we’re able to continuously read their internal comms for some time now.”

Scotland Yard and FBI have confirmed that their call was intercepted by the hackers, according to Scotland Yard’s spokesman ” We are aware of the video which relates to an FBI conference call involving a PCeU representative. The matter is being investigated by the FBI. We continue to carry out a full assessment. We are not prepared to discuss further.”
